No new deaths recorded as B.C. announces 108 more cases of COVID-19


health officials announced 108 new cases of COVID-19 and no additional deaths on Tuesday. In a written statement, Provincial Health Officer Dr. Bonnie Henry and Health Minister Adrian Dix said there are currently 1,496 active cases of people infected with the novel coronavirus in B.C. The provincial death toll from the disease is now 1,734 lives lost out of 146,561 confirmed cases to date.
